Depth Floor
Challenge: The implementation assumes the new
summarizationSweepIntervalMsconfig field exists at runtime. That is not true for already-existing gitignoredai/mcp/server/memory-core/config.mjsfiles in the three-clone swarm setup. I verified this checkout's live config has no such key (hasKey:false). With the current code,SessionService.startSunsetHandoverPoller()readsundefined, logs the sweep as disabled, and never starts the Piece C interval.Rhetorical-Drift Audit: Fail until the contract cleanup below lands. The PR says Piece C is added and defaulted to 10 minutes, but in existing local configs the mechanical runtime path disables it. The PR also says
Resolves #10813while AC7 is explicitly still post-merge empirical validation.

Cross-Skill / Config-Template Integration Audit
Required Action. This PR changes
ai/mcp/server/memory-core/config.template.mjs, so the config-template guide applies. The PR body lists the new key, but does not state whether gitignored localconfig.mjsfiles require manual shape/key updates or whether MCP harness restart is required/recommended.This is not cosmetic. Empirical check in this checkout:
{"hasKey":false}and the current runtime code does:
const sweepIntervalMs = aiConfig.data.summarizationSweepIntervalMs; ... if (sweepIntervalMs > 0) { this._sweepIntervalId = setInterval(...); }With a stale local config,
undefined > 0is false, so the new 10-minute default does not apply. Required fix: add a runtime fallback/default for omitted local config keys, and update the PR body with clone-sync plus restart guidance. If env override support depends on updating localenvBindings, say that explicitly too.

Summary
Closes the AC3 gap in #10813's A+B+C summary-restoration architecture. Adds an unconditional periodic summarization sweep that catches sessions which closed without either a graceful sunset event (Piece B) OR an SSE-disconnect signal (
queueSummarizationJob) — the hard-crash edge case where neither path fires.What landed previously (audit confirmed)
63afd010ec9765317cSummarizationJobsSQLite table +queueSummarizationJob+processPendingSummarizations+ lease semanticsWhat this PR adds (AC3 + AC6)
Substrate
aiConfig.summarizationSweepIntervalMs(default600000= 10 min) + env overrideNEO_SUMMARIZATION_SWEEP_INTERVAL_MS. Set to0to disable Piece C while keeping Piece B sunset-poll active.SessionService.runPeriodicSummarizationSweep()— gated onautoSummarize=trueANDisPrimary=true; fires the existingsummarizeSessions({})drift-detection scan; records outcome viaHealthService.recordPeriodicSweep().SessionService.startSunsetHandoverPoller()extended to also start the periodic sweepsetIntervalalongside the 30s sunset poller. Idempotent on re-invocation.Healthcheck observability (AC6)
HealthServicenow exposes under the existingstartupblock:periodicSweepStatus:'completed' | 'failed' | 'not_attempted'periodicSweepDetails:{processed, lastSweepAt}on success,{error, lastSweepAt}on failureNew
recordPeriodicSweep(status, details)method mirrors the existingrecordStartupSummarizationpattern (clears healthcheck cache on update).Tests (AC4)
SessionService.PeriodicSweep.spec.mjs— 4/4 passing (729ms):summarizeSessionsand records sweep when both flags trueisPrimary=false(single-writer enforcement)autoSummarize=falsefailedsweep whensummarizeSessionsthrowsAdjacent specs verified unaffected:
SessionService.PrimaryFlagGate.spec.mjsandSessionService.SunsetPoller.spec.mjsboth 4/4 green.Docs (AC5)
learn/agentos/MemoryCore.md— new### Periodic Safety-Net Sweep (Piece C of #10813)section after Sunset Handover Poller doclearn/agentos/DeploymentCookbook.md— env-var inventory addsNEO_SUMMARIZATION_SWEEP_INTERVAL_MSrow in Section 6Idempotency note
Piece C reuses the existing
summarizeSessions({})drift-detection primitive. Per-session summarization claims an exclusiveSummarizationJobslease (the same lease primitive used by Piece B and theprocessPendingSummarizationsqueue-processor), so concurrent triggers from the same primary instance no-op cleanly. No race surface introduced.Out of scope
